Local people in need have received a helping hand from Stax Bristol.
The Bristol branch has donated a range of kitchen equipment and consumable items to the Bristol arm of the Foodcycle team, which provide free meals for the community at Barton Hill Settlement.
“We stock a huge range of homewares and kitchen equipment for our independent retail customers,” says Rob Best, manager of the Stax Bristol branch. “When we heard about the great work that the Foodcycle team do we felt we had to help out and provide them with some of the items they need to keep helping local people.”
“Our team, many of whom are dedicated volunteers, work extremely hard to create a welcoming atmosphere and a delicious hot meal for the people who come to us, and so we were delighted when Stax contacted us about making a donation,” explains Foodcycle’s Regional Manager, Justin Powell. “We were invited to the Stax warehouse where the staff were keen to help us to fulfil our very big shopping list!
“They provided us with a huge range of items - everything from cutting boards and tea towels through to cooking rings and hand wash. These sorts of items are really vital to the work we do. They will make a great difference in helping us cook and supply a 3-course meal to people who appreciate it, so we’re very grateful to Stax for their generosity.”
Stax have made donations to a number of similar organisations in other parts of the country.
